Program Overview

The BSc (Hons) Physiotherapy degree at the University of Derby is designed to develop the expertise, knowledge, and skills required to practice as a professional physiotherapist. This programme prepares students to integrate seamlessly into multidisciplinary health and social care teams, equipping them with essential clinical, leadership, digital, and research skills.

Distinctive Features

  • Accreditation: The course is approved by the Health and Care Professions Council (HCPC) and the Chartered Society of Physiotherapy (CSP), enabling graduates to apply for professional registration.
  • Practice-Based Learning: Almost half of the programme consists of practice-based learning in various real-world settings, including NHS, private, and voluntary sectors.
  • Inter-professional Environment: Students learn alongside peers from nursing, mental health, and social care disciplines, reflecting the collaborative nature of modern healthcare.
  • Advanced Facilities: Instruction takes place in realistic settings, including an NHS-standard six-bed hospital ward, a home-environment simulator, and a rehabilitation kitchen.

About University of Derby

The University of Derby, established in 1851 and based in Derby, United Kingdom, combines a strong practical focus with supportive student services. With around 19,685 students and a welcoming international community, Derby offers career-oriented programs across business, engineering, health, arts and sciences. The campus is known for close links to local industry, applied research and professional training that help students develop workplace-ready skills.
